ThePlace
Login
Home
Photos
News
Rating
Forum
Search
Photos
Liu Wen
Photo #904971
Liu Wen - photo #1402
1666x2500
1
683x1026
723x946
Liu Wen photo #904971 (1402 of 1604)
Added: 2017-01-28 00:00:00
Size: 683x1026 px (0 Kb)
Liu Wen
1.6K
6M
More Liu Wen photos
2048x1424
1023x1539
1023x1534
960x1234
View all Liu Wen photos (1604)